Cob Creek

Image of Cob CreekSet on a hill overlooking the Kabelous River and Jeffreys Bay lays Cob Creek, a special place with natural beauty in abundance. Cob Creek will boast an 18 hole Signature golf-course, 32 hectares of the Eastern Cape's first wine-lands, and lifestyle estate on the Kabeljous River, reaching almost to the sea.

Cob Creek presents a natural course layout, vitally important to Golf Course Design. The undulating course will offer stunning elevated views of the Indian Ocean on one side and play through the Kabeljous River Valley on the other. The golf course will be a sweeping spectacle of fairways and rolling greens, with indigenous flora and fauna juxtaposed neatly against the cultured vineyards and a low density exclusive housing estate that will add to Cob Creek's allure.

After believing in the quality of Cob Creek's soil and climate, research and scientific results proved that theyImage of Cob Creek logo were comparable to some of the best wine-lands in the Western Cape, the main wine producing area in South Africa. 'Good soil produces good wines.'The first planting of vineyards started in 2005 and Cob Creek Estate presently boasts 32 hectares of quality 'wine on the vine', a first for the Eastern Cape. Cob Creek Estate has pioneered viticulture in the Eastern Cape, South Africa.
